Timberline Landscaping Launches 9th Annual Christmas Lights Interactive Map

  • November 29, 2021

Who doesn’t enjoy a festive Christmas Lights tour?!

The holiday season is here again, and there is no better way to celebrate than to take a Christmas Lights tour around Colorado Springs! Local Colorado Springs landscape company, Timberline Landscaping, is excited to announce its 9th Annual Christmas Lights Guide. Timberline invites locals and visitors to view the holiday lights using their comprehensive interactive map of more than 100 homes and businesses throughout the Colorado Springs area.

“After 9 seasons of involvement from residents, we have created a very fun and festive list of properties. Fans have begun looking forward to our launch date, with more than one million visitors using the guide since its creation. This year we have a fun scavenger hunt and a great playlist to enjoy while you tour.” says Stephanie Early, Chief of Strategy for Timberline Landscaping.

This year’s featured properties include 4910 Nugent Drive, where homeowner Mark has been collecting canned goods for Care & Share for the last 7 years. He says “The beauty of lights lifts people up. I want to bring a smile to people’s faces and help them remember what the season is about.”

From the northernmost to the southernmost point on the map, drivers can cover more than 40 festive miles. With nearly 30 cocoa or coffee stops on the guide, there are plenty of options to stop for a treat to complete the holiday experience.

Lights guide travelers can showcase images they take while touring by using the hashtag #COSpringsLightsGuide when they post.
